For starters you’ll have to get comfortable with California vital records. But what are California vital records? Vital records are records that tell you about the life and death of someone. They include things like birth and death records, which is exactly what you’ll need to access if you’re trying to locate someone or if you’re trying to fill in the missing branches of your family tree. There are, however, a few problems with accessing some of these records, and most of them occur simply because the person who is trying to access them simply doesn’t know how to do it correctly or where to go. Let’s start with the first tip: the first tip is to know your prey. This means that you should know exactly who you’re trying to locate. Get a first name and a last name and, if it’s a woman, a maiden name if possible. This makes it much easier to find things like California death records or even California birth certificates. The next tip is to be flexible! Another problem that people have when they’re trying to access California vital records is that they’re so fixated on finding the exact record that they want that they forget that they may be able to get the information that they need out of other documents as well as the one they’re looking for. For instance California death records may tell you the name of the person that you are looking for’s parents, as this information is often included on the records. And California birth certificates are a great place to turn if you’re looking for records about parents as well as records about their child. And the final tip is to make sure that you write everything down. That is where most people wind up having a huge problem. They assume that they’ll be able to remember everything and then wind up getting very frustrated when they can’t. Instead of dealing with frustrating, keep copies of all of the California birth certificates and California death records you find and take the time to write everything down as well.
